Abstract

A portable unit worn by a subject, comprising a medical monitoring device, a data processing module with memory and transmitter for collecting, monitoring, and storing the subject's physiological data and also issuing the subject's medical alarm conditions via wireless communications network to the appropriate location for expeditious dispatch of assistance. The unit also works in conjunction with a central reporting system for long term collection and storage of the subject's physiological data. The unit may have the capability to automatically dispense chemicals that may alleviate or assist in recovery from an illness.

What is claimed is:  
     
         1 . A portable medical monitoring device, for generating, collecting, and evaluating physiological data relating to a subject, said device transmitting data via a communications medium to a central reporting system, comprising: 
 (a) at least one medical sensor for generating current physiological data relating to a condition of said subject;    (b) a data storage device for electronically storing said physiological data for a predetermined period;    (c) a transmitter for transmitting said physiological data of said subject to a central reporting system in response to a first output control signal;    (d) data processing means for evaluating said physiological data and generating said first output control signal in response to pre-determined parameters in said evaluation, said data processing means also generating a plurality of input/output control signals; and      7  (e) at least one output device communicating at least one of said input/output control signals to said subject.    
     
     
         2 . The portable medical monitoring device as in  claim 1 , wherein said physiological data is generated in response to said subject's physical condition, including said subject's heart rate, pulse rate, blood pressure, breathing rate, heart EKG activity, or body temperature.  
     
     
         3 . The portable medical monitoring device as in  claim 1 , wherein said first output control signal includes a command to transmit an emergency call.  
     
     
         4 . The portable medical monitoring device as in  claim 1 , wherein said portable medical monitoring device includes a dispense unit having a tube filled with medication, and said first output control signal includes a command to said dispense unit to dispense medication.  
     
     
         5 . The portable medical monitoring device as in  claim 1 , wherein said at least one output device includes a beeper, and one of said plurality of input/output control signals is a signal to activate said beeper.  
     
     
         6 . The portable medical monitoring device as in  claim 1 , wherein said at least one output device includes a vibrator and one of said plurality of input/output control signals is a signal to activate said vibrator.  
     
     
         7 . The portable medical monitoring device as in  claim 1 , wherein said at least one output device includes a screen display, and one of said plurality of output control signals is a signal to display selected data on said screen monitor.  
     
     
         8 . The portable medical monitoring device as in  claim 1 , wherein said transmitter is an interactive paging device whereby a page is sent over a wireless communications network to a central reporting system.  
     
     
         9 . The portable medical monitoring device as in  claim 1 , wherein said transmitter is a PCS network cellular network phone whereby a phone call is made to a central reporting system.  
     
     
         10 . The portable medical monitoring device as in  claim 1 , wherein said data processing means includes a central processing unit (CPU) which interprets and executes instructions.  
     
     
         11 . The portable medical monitoring device as in  claim 1 , wherein said portable medical monitoring device further comprises at least one input means for enabling manual entry of one or more of a plurality of instructions to said data processing means.  
     
     
         12 . The portable medical monitoring device as in  claim 11 , wherein said at least one input means includes push buttons which can be manually depressed and said plurality of instructions include downloading, storing, and displaying a subject's current physiological data.  
     
     
         13 . The portable medical monitoring device as in  claim 1 , wherein said at least one output device includes at least one external data communications port for downloading and uploading said physiological data to an external remote device.  
     
     
         14 . The portable medical monitoring device as in  claim 13 , wherein said external remote device is connected to said central reporting system.  
     
     
         15 . The portable medical monitoring device as in  claim 1 , wherein said physiological data includes a device identification code which identifies a subject to said central reporting system.  
     
     
         16 . The portable medical monitoring device as in  claim 15 , wherein said physiological data transmitted by said transmitter further comprises a subject profile including subject's name, home address, and medical conditions.  
     
     
         17 . A portable medical monitoring device, for generating, collecting, and evaluating physiological data relating to a subject and the subject's geographic location, said device transmitting data via a communications link to a central reporting system, comprising: 
 (a) at least one medical sensor for generating current physiological data relating to a condition of said subject;    (b) a data storage device for electronically storing said physiological data for a predetermined period;    (c) a GPS receiver for determining the geographic coordinates of a subject;    (d) a wireless transmitter for transmitting said physiological data and said geographic coordinates of said subject to a central reporting system in response to a first output control signal;    (e) data processing means for evaluating said physiological data and generating said first output control signal and a plurality of other output control signals; and    (f) at least one output device for communicating with said subject in response to at least one of said other output control signals.
